Foursquare for Android gets restaurant menus


Via AboutFoursquare:
When foursquare said restaurant menus were “coming soon” to the mobile apps, I don’t think anyone expected it was only a matter of hours. The foursquare Android app was updated overnight to include the new menus feature along with a few other minor updates.
The menus appear as a link right from the venue screen, pushing photos a little farther down. They show up broken into sections just like the menus on the foursquare site.
Other changes appearing in version 2012.1.18:
  • Workaround for GPS bug affecting some devices.
  • Updated layout for pre-check-in screen.
  • Venue map zooming for nearby vs worldwide.
The new version is available for download in the Android Market.
PS While we’re on the topic of menus, they’ve started appearing today for many large chains, like Dunkin’ Donuts, Panera Bread, Starbucks and Applebee’s.
